Ethical Considerations in Surrogate Decision Making: Family Meeting Guide

Thursday, May 16 at 12 p.m. Eastern

Pre-Approved CEs: 1 Hour RN, SW, and CCM ETHICS

Surrogate decision making raises many ethical issues. In all settings, decisions regarding goals of care often must be made by either elected proxies or next-of-kin on behalf of patients. These conversations, often involving high stakes and occurring in high states of arousal, are rife with ethical concerns. This session will present a framework for recognizing and managing ethical considerations, including legal topics, cultural issues and self-awareness of implicit bias and assumptions, and offer a practical guide to conducting holistic, patient-centric and ethically sound meetings.

Delivering LGBTQ+ Inclusive Healthcare: A Roadmap for Case Managers

Tuesday, May 28 from 12-1:30 p.m. Eastern

1.5 Hour RN, SW, CCM Ethics, CDMS Ethics, CRC Ethics and CPHQ (Approval Pending)

This LGBTQ+ roadmap for case managers aims to address the knowledge, skills and strategies needed to deliver culturally competent and affirming care to LGBTQ+ patients. You will learn about best practices in LGBTQ+ patient-centered care and leave with a wealth of resources, including guidelines, tools and references, to support their practice in the field. By the end of the session, case managers will be better prepared to deliver patient-centered care that is culturally competent, inclusive and affirming for LGBTQ+ patients. This knowledge and skillset are essential for improving healthcare quality, reducing disparities and promoting equity within the healthcare system.

CMSA is thrilled to welcome our new Affiliate Partner, the Association for the Advancement of Blood & Biotherapies! AABB is an international association committed to improving health through the development and delivery of standards, accreditation and educational programs that focus on optimizing patient and donor care and safety. They strive to create a “connected community dedicated to advancing transfusion medicine and biotherapies. From donor to patient.
